Population: 8,920 Area: 20.8 Square Miles

Commute Times: Hartford: 60 Minutes; JFK Airport: 75 Minutes; Manhattan: 60 Minutes; Stamford: 25 Minutes; White Plains, NY: 40 Minutes

Schools: 1 Elementary School Complex, 1 Middle School, 1 High School

Recreation/attractions: Public Parks and Playgrounds, Tennis Courts, Private Country Clubs, Devil's Den Nature Conservancy, Saugatuck River

Incorporated in 1787, Weston is a rustic town of sweeping fields, ponds, riverside vistas and thickly wooded forests. The natural splendor of the area is undoubtedly a prime attraction to residents, but when coupled with comfortable commutes to urban centers, a solid school system and excellent recreational offerings, Weston is a choice spot for family living.

Residents carefully preserve the beauty of Weston. Almost 30 years ago, a master plan was adopted to protect vast areas of land from development, and establishing a 2-acre lot minimum requirement for new homes on remaining lands. As a result, the attractive homes of Weston are set on spacious lots and surrounded by natural beauty. Residences include traditional colonials, charming farmhouses and streamlined contemporary designs. There are no condominiums or apartment complexes in Weston.

The picturesque terrain also lends itself to outdoor and sporting pleasure. 1,400 acres of land comprise Devil's Den, a nature preserve, which features hiking trails, picnic areas and a lovely pond. The town recreation department hosts a wealth of year-round activities for all ages, including ski trips, indoor swimming, athletic programs and innovative camps. Water sports are enjoyed at the town swimming pond and at the beaches of neighboring Westport, and a riding academy provides equestrian fun. Several private clubs offer skeet and trap shooting and indoor/outdoor tennis courts and golf courses.

Weston's children receive a strong academic foundation at a uniquely interconnected school complex. Traditional coursework is supplemented by a wide selection of culturally enriching programs, including music, visual arts,  drama and stagecraft athletic leagues and interscholastic programs. Special services are provided for students with particular needs.
